BILT: 3D Instructions is an innovative mobile application designed to transform the way you assemble products. It replaces confusing paper manuals with interactive 3D animations, guiding you step-by-step through the construction of furniture, toys, appliances, and more right on your smartphone or tablet, making the assembly process visual, intuitive, and significantly less frustrating.
Key Features
The app stands out with its rich, user-centric features. It provides fully animated 3D instructions that you can rotate, zoom, and view from any angle to understand exactly how parts fit together. Many guides also include helpful tool and part checklists, narrated tips, and the ability to mark steps as complete. The library is constantly updated with instructions for thousands of products from numerous popular brands.
Pros & Cons
Like any tool, BILT has its strengths and weaknesses. A major advantage is its ability to drastically simplify complex assemblies, reducing errors and saving time. The interactive 3D models are far superior to static diagrams. However, the app's utility depends on your product being in its database. It also requires a stable internet connection to download instruction sets, and the detailed animations can consume significant battery life during a long assembly project.
Functions
BILT’s core functions are all geared towards a seamless assembly experience. Its primary function is to deliver step-by-step animated instructions. Beyond that, it offers useful organizational features such as:
- Saving and categorizing your product instructions for easy future access.
- Providing a list of all required parts and tools before you begin.
- Allowing you to tap through animations at your own pace.
- Including safety warnings and pro-tips at critical steps.
